Amanda Holden
Amanda Louise Holden (born 16 February 1971) is an English media personality, actress, television presenter, singer, and author. She has judged on the television talent show competition Britain's Got Talent since the show began its run in 2007 on ITV. As an actress, Holden played the role of Mel in Kiss Me Kate (1998–2000), Geraldine Titley in The Grimleys (1999-2001), Sarah Trevanion in Wild at Heart (2006–2008), Lizzie, the Ring Mistress, in Big Top (2009), and the title role in Thoroughly Modern Millie, for which she was nominated for a Laurence Olivier Award.

Defiant Amanda Holden cheerfully heads to work after 5G 'scaremongering'

Amanda Holden is not letting her recent slip-up stop her from presenting on Heart Radio. The Britain's Got Talent judge, 49, was under fire for apparently accidentally sharing a petition on Twitter to stop the introduction of 5G in the UK.

But it seems as though she's brushed off the mistake as she headed to seemingly abandoned Global House in central London, where she and Ashley Roberts hopped up on desks and performed an impromptu fashion show.

The presenters danced together as they marched from one side of the long desk to the other. Amanda shared hilarious video of the pair strutting their stuff while donning their outfits, as she paired her look with disposable rubber gloves amid health concerns.
